The speeds of Ram and Rohan are 40km/hr and 50km/hr
respectively. Rohan initially is at a place A and Ram is at a place B. The distance between A and B is 520km. Ram started his journey 4 hours earlier than Rohan to meet each other. If they meet each other at a place O somewhere between A and B, then the distance between O and B isSolution
Let the distance covered of x km by Ram Time taken is ‘t’ hours, then Distance covered by Ram = speed × time x = 40 × t ………………………(i) Distance covered by Rohan (520 - x )km by Rohan. Distance covered by Rohan = speed × time (520 – x) = 50 × (t – 4) ………………………(ii) Putting the value of ‘t’ in eq (ii) from eq (i) (520 – x) = 50 × (x/40 – 4) 520 - x = 5x/4 – 200 520 + 200 = 5x/4 + x 720 = 9x/4 x = 320 km
